For harsh rugged military applications,<br />

wide temperature range is key for<br />

power supplies. Designed as a turn-key<br />

solution for applications requiring input<br />

to output isolation, the EW from Calex<br />

offers three input ranges with five output<br />

voltage combinations. This 10 watt<br />

EW Single Output Series of DC/DC converters<br />

offers available input ranges of 9<br />

to 18V, 18 to 36V and 36 to 75 VDC. The<br />

output voltage options are 2.5, 3.3, 5, 12<br />

and 15 VDC. The input to output isolation<br />

is 1500 VDC. All outputs are tightly<br />

regulated for problem-free operation.<br />

The EW is housed in a five-sided shielded<br />

metal enclosure. Case size is 1.25” x 0.80”<br />

x 0.4”H. All models are fully encapsulated<br />

for improved thermal performance.<br />

The operating temperature range of<br />

the EW is -40° to +90°C. The switching<br />

frequency of all models is 400 kHz with<br />

efficiencies as high as 87%. Output noise<br />

is as low as 50 mV peak to peak. Output<br />

voltage accuracy is +/-0.6%. Line and load<br />

regulation is +/-0.3% and +/-0.5% respectively.<br />

Temperature coefficient is +/-<br />

3% and all models are protected through<br />

continuous short circuit protection.<br />

<strong>Inrush</strong> <strong>Current</strong> Issues<br />

Another issue that affects reliability<br />

is the control of incoming current. Addressing<br />

that need, VPT has expanded<br />

its product line with a new power protection<br />

module, the DVCL <strong>Inrush</strong> <strong>Current</strong><br />

Limiter. The DVCL controls potentially<br />

damaging inrush current drawn by DC/<br />

DC converters, EMI filters and discrete<br />

capacitors during startup. With a power<br />

capacity of 200W, users can protect multiple<br />

downstream VPT DC/DC converters<br />

using a single, lightweight DVCL<br />

module. <strong>Inrush</strong> current is the spike of<br />

current drawn by a power supply when it<br />

is turned on. Large inrush currents might<br />

be governed by a system-level specification.<br />

High spike currents can create electromagnetic<br />

interference in adjacent circuitry,<br />

trip an upstream circuit breaker,<br />

or overwhelm the over-current protection<br />

of a solid state power controller. The<br />

DVCL <strong>Inrush</strong> <strong>Current</strong> Limiter functions<br />

by limiting the rate of rise of its output<br />

voltage. It will also control the inrush<br />

current of discrete input capacitors.<br />

Also in the vein of harsh environment<br />

supplies, railway requirements have<br />

a lot of overlap with the rugged requirements<br />

of military applications. TDK-<br />

Lambda America has expanded its line<br />

of railway DC/DC converters with the<br />

introduction of the new 24V input, 100watt,<br />

CN100A24 Series. These quarter<br />

brick modules operate off a wide range of<br />

DC inputs from 14.4 to 36.0 VDC, which<br />

is widely used in the railway industry, and<br />

for 24-volt vehicles. Available with output<br />

voltages of 5V, 12V, 15V or 24 VDC (adjustable<br />

±10%), these fully regulated and<br />

isolated power modules deliver exceptional<br />

performance.<br />

Designed for very harsh environments,<br />

the CN100A24 Series meets the<br />

stringent shock and vibration requirements<br />

of IEC61373 Category 1, Grade B.<br />

These baseplate-cooled power converters<br />

have standard pin-outs and provide full<br />

output power from -40° to +100°C at the<br />
